What Exactly Defines a Non-Commercial Vehicle?

Wiki Article

Understanding the distinction between commercial vehicles and non-commercial ones is essential for navigating numerous legal and insurance requirements. A non-commercial vehicle is generally characterized as a machine primarily employed for personal transportation purposes, as opposed to earning revenue or engaging in business activities. This means the vehicle's primary function isn't concerning professional endeavors. While there are common guidelines, specific interpretations can vary depending on locations.

Understanding Vehicle Classifications: Commercial vs. Non-Commercial

Vehicles are broadly categorized into two primary types: commercial and non-commercial. Commercial vehicles are intended for business purposes, such as transporting goods or passengers for a fee. They often possess unique characteristics, like heavier construction and larger cargo capacity. Non-commercial vehicles, on the other hand, are chiefly used for personal transportation. Examples include cars, SUVs, and motorcycles.

Understanding these variations is vital for various reasons, including insurance policies, licensing, and traffic rules.
